Why access fails
Users report four recurring failure modes: authentication mismatches (wrong username, outdated phone on file), new passkey or biometric sign-in requirements, browser/app technical errors (white screen, large cookie/header errors), and account migration or provisioning delays after a corporate transition to HealthEquity. authentication mismatches
Immediate troubleshooting checklist
- Confirm username and email exactly match your employer enrollment record (case-sensitive where noted). username and email
- Attempt password reset via the HealthEquity reset link and choose the verified phone or email option shown on the page. password reset
- Use a desktop browser (Chrome or Edge recommended) with a cleared cache and cookies, then disable VPN or privacy browser extensions. desktop browser
- If the mobile app shows a blank screen, uninstall and reinstall the official HealthEquity app and retry sign-in. mobile app
- Check whether your employer recently migrated WageWorks accounts to HealthEquity; migration windows can temporarily block access. account migration
Step-by-step access guide
- Open a modern desktop browser (Chrome, Edge, or Safari) and go to the employer-specific sign-in page (usually healthequity.com/wageworks). employer-specific
- Click "Forgot password" and follow the flow; note the partially-obscured phone or email the site displays-if it doesn't match your current contact, contact HR. Forgot password
- When asked to verify identity, choose the method that matches your last enrolled contact information (SMS, voice, or email). verify identity
- If asked to set up a passkey or passcode and you cannot complete it, attempt the classic username/password flow on a desktop-some environments retain legacy login while apps force the new passkey. passkey setup
- If you still see a blank white page or an Nginx/cookie header error, clear cookies for healthequity.com, close the browser, and try in an incognito window; if using a company-managed device, try a personal device. blank white
Common error messages and fixes
| Error text | Likely cause | First fix to try |
|---|---|---|
| "We could not verify your identity" | Phone/email on file mismatch or aging contact data | Confirm contact with HR; request HR to update record or call support for manual verification |
| Blank white screen after login | Browser cookie/header size, extension/VPN, or temporary server-side error | Clear cookies, disable VPN/extensions, try incognito or another browser |
| "Passkey required" but cannot enroll | Device not compatible or incomplete passkey rollout for your employer | Use desktop username/password flow or contact HR for exemption/migration timing |
| "Account not found" | Employer migration incomplete or wrong portal (employer vs participant) | Verify correct portal URL with HR (employer vs participant login) and check migration notices |
This table illustrates typical mappings between error text and practical fixes; treat it as a prioritized troubleshooting map. troubleshooting map

Support contacts and escalation path
Use this three-step escalation path: (1) confirm employer enrollment and contacts via HR, (2) follow HealthEquity automated reset flows, (3) call HealthEquity participant support if unresolved. escalation path
| Contact point | When to use |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| HR/benefits team | Account provisioning, contact updates, or migration questions | Ask for a system confirmation or case number before calling vendor |
| HealthEquity participant support | Login issues after confirming employer data | Support is typically 24/7; have last four of SSN and employer name ready |
| Employer portal admin | Employer-side portal issues (COBRA, plan renewals) | Employer admins have separate access and can submit cases directly via the employer portal |

Security and privacy considerations
Do not disclose full SSN, full phone numbers, or full email addresses over public chat or unverified support channels; HealthEquity and employers will only request minimal identity data (last 4 of SSN, partial phone) during verification. security and privacy

Recommended employer actions
- Send a pre-migration communication listing exact portal URLs and the expected cutoff windows. pre-migration
- Provide an HR helpdesk script that includes the vendor case number template to speed vendor triage. HR helpdesk
- Collect and verify employee contact data quarterly to reduce verification mismatches. collect contact
When to involve compliance or legal
If access failures prevent COBRA notices, claims payments, or create regulatory deadlines being missed, escalate immediately to your compliance team and request a vendor incident report and remediation plan. COBRA notices

[How do I know which portal to use]?
Check your employer's benefits communication or HR portal for the exact sign-in URL-participants use healthequity.com/wageworks (or the HealthEquity participant portal) while employer/administrator sign-ins use a separate employer portal; using the wrong portal can result in "account not found." sign-in URL
[Can I bypass passkey setup]?
Passkey enforcement varies by rollout and employer; some users retain username/password access on desktop during phased rollouts while mobile apps may require passkey enrollment-coordinate with HR if passkey enrollment fails. passkey enforcement
[What if the phone number on file is old]?
If the verification flow shows a partially-obscured phone number you no longer control, ask HR to update your contact or open a vendor support case to complete manual verification using alternate identity proofs. phone number

[What info to have when calling support]?
Have your employer name, last four of SSN, date of birth, employee ID (if available), and the exact error message or screenshot ready when contacting HealthEquity support to speed verification and case creation. calling support
